2015 Herald Motor Company Classic
MOT Pass Rate & Pre-MOT Checklist

Used 2015 Herald Motor Company Classics usually pass their MOT, but around 8% still fail, most often for brake lining or pad worn below 1.0mm, a wheel excessively corroded, damaged or distorted and brake lining or pad missing or incorrectly mounted. Based on 50 MOT tests from DVSA data, this page shows how this model performs and what to check before your test.

Top Failure Reasons

Common MOT failures for this model

  1. 1

    Brake lining or pad worn below 1.0mm

    11.8%
  2. 2

    A wheel excessively corroded, damaged or distorted

    11.8%
  3. 3

    Brake lining or pad missing or incorrectly mounted

    5.9%
  4. 4

    Braking system component modification unsafe

    5.9%
  5. 5

    Exhaust system leaking or insecure

    5.9%

Based on DVSA statistics from 50 recorded tests.
